TORRANCE, CA (SEND2PRESS NEWSWIRE) — Zane Lalani, author of “Teenagers Guide to the Beatles,” is the featured guest on the latest Send2Press entertainment Podcast. The musical guest is The G-Man, who previews his latest CD on Delvian Records, “Motion Potion.” The Podcast (www.Send2Press.com/podcast/) is hosted by author and musician Christopher Simmons, and can be listened to “on-demand” in both RealAudio and MP3 formats, and subscribed to via iTunes, RSS/XML, or an Odeo Channel.

Zane Lalani, a life long Beatles fan, was only five when the Beatles hit the big time, but their influence on his life was immediate. From their music to their hairstyle, from their clothing to their cartoons, Zane followed them closely. At age eight, he wore out his teenage brother’s Sgt. Peppers Lonely Hearts Club Band album and had memorized the lyrics. His love for the Beatles and their music never faded and Zane still enjoys the entire spectrum of the Beatles’ repertoire, including their solo work. “Teenagers Guide to the Beatles” (ISBN 0965874079, Hardcover, 216 pages) is available from book sellers and at www.AverStreamPress.com.
